Sirius Satellite Acquiring Issue

I know this has been discussed in other BMW forums, but not specifically about the X5.

Problem: Since getting the car 4 weeks ago the Sirius satellite will intermittently stop working, the radio will fix at channel 255 with no sound. The display will show the available stations but nothing happens when a station is chosen.

The issue never occurs in the morning after vehicle has been off for the night. Usually, but not always, occurs after parking the car and re-entering after a short stop.

Once it occurs the only way to try to get it back is to turn off the car and park it for 15-20 minutes. May or may not fix it after restart.

I've read that some people with other BMW's who have the same issue will leave the key in the car for 30 seconds, allow the satellite to acquire, and then turn the engine on. I've tried this and it works 80% of the time.

My dealer has no clue what this is and asked me to bring it in when it happens. Drove all the way there, satellite "acquiring" for 1/2 hour, parkewd the car for 5 minutes, dealer comes to see, car turned on, satellite works normally. I feel like Lou Costello......

That problem should never happen and I've never had it occur in one of my BMWs. I would suggest your Sirius tuner box is defective, ask them to swap it out for a new one. That is a hassle since it changes what Sirius has on file for you.

Sounds like the box is having issues when it is warm.
